Cherokee Elementary School

5700 Prescott Road
Alexandria, LA 71301

Serving 600 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Cherokee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Louisiana for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 23% (which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 32%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50% (which is higher than the Louisiana state average of 42%).
The student:teacher ratio of 14:1 is equal to the Louisiana state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 74%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Louisiana state average of 59% (majority Black).

Cherokee Elementary School's student population of 600 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 42 teachers has grown by 31% over five school years.
